1. Treat Wyoming as a defined service area, not a demand forecast
The Census identifies Wyoming as a municipality in Kent County, Michigan. Its 2020–2024 ACS five-year population estimate is 77,353, with a margin of error of 49. That is useful for describing the city and confirming the geographic context, but it cannot prove how many people search for a lawyer, how many firms compete for those searches, or how many Local Services Ads inquiries may occur. A law firm may serve Wyoming alone, Kent County, surrounding communities or another deliberately limited area. Those are different choices, and each can change which calls are appropriate to accept.
Recommended approach
Begin by listing the locations your firm actually serves and the locations it does not. Review whether the desired service area matches your consultation capacity, court or meeting logistics, licensing position and case economics.
